Clear PVC Bag Material Processing and Quality Verification

Advanced Manufacturing Methods for Clear PVC Film

Developing dependable clear PVC bags starts at the molecular stage. During calendering or extrusion blow molding, raw vinyl resin is synthesized with custom thermal stabilizers, lubricants, and processing aids. The polymer melt's mechanical profile determines the clear bag's ultimate tensile performance and puncture resistance.

For shrink wrap variations, the extruded material is oriented along machine direction (MD) and transverse direction (TD). This orientation alignment ensures that during application, heat tunnels spark controlled, uniform shrinkage around the wrapped target without leaving unsightly wrinkles or structural splits.

Material Comparison & Physical Specifications

Evaluating the performance metrics of PVC against alternative high-clarity wrapping materials used in packaging applications.

Property / Metric High-Clarity PVC Film Polyolefin (POF) Polyethylene (PE) CPP / OPP Film
Optical Haze Index (%) < 2.5% < 3.0% > 6.0% < 2.0%
Tensile Strength (MPa) 50 - 75 80 - 110 15 - 35 120 - 200
Shrinkage Rate (TD / MD) Up to 55% / 45% Up to 65% / 65% Up to 70% / 20% Negligible (heat seal only)
Sealing Temperature Range 130°C - 150°C 160°C - 180°C 140°C - 170°C 120°C - 140°C
Best Applications Cosmetics, Labels, Tapes, Bags Multi-packs, Toys, Food Heavy Logistics, Pallets Bread wrappers, Lamination

Meeting Strict International Regulations

Global regulatory bodies continue to tighten restrictions on PVC formulation additives. Compliance with the European Chemicals Agency’s (ECHA) REACH regulations and European Union RoHS directives requires eliminating hazardous heavy metal stabilizers, specifically lead and cadmium. Our production processes rely exclusively on eco-friendly calcium-zinc (Ca-Zn) or organic tin stabilizer packages.

For US-bound shipments, we ensure compliance with California Proposition 65 by keeping heavy phthalate plasticizer levels well below the 1000 ppm limit. We substitute these with safe alternatives like DOTP or polymer plasticizers. These compounds have low migration potential, making them suitable for clear bags that might contact cosmetics or skin.

Sustainable PVC & Bio-Attributed Chemistry

As the circular economy advances, the technical roadmap for PVC clear packaging is shifting toward bio-attributed resins and post-consumer recycled (PCR) content. Bio-attributed PVC uses plant-derived ethylene instead of fossil fuels, lowering the overall carbon footprint of manufacturing. Q1: What parameters differentiate clear PVC bags from POF or PE alternatives?
Clear PVC bags and films are preferred for applications requiring optical clarity and rigidity, such as cosmetic pouches, presentation boxes, and shrink sleeve labels. PVC provides excellent resistance to punctures, oils, and moisture, along with high gloss. POF (Polyolefin) is more flexible, offers multi-directional shrinkage, and is often chosen for multi-packs or direct food contact. PE (Polyethylene) is a heavier material designed for industrial pallets and large-scale shipping wrap where strength matters more than transparency.

Q4: What is the recommended storage environment to avoid film blocking or degradation?
We recommend storing PVC clear films and bags in a climate-controlled warehouse at temperatures between 15°C and 25°C, with a relative humidity of 40% to 60%. Keep the material away from direct sunlight, moisture, and heat sources to prevent premature shrinking, blocking (layers sticking together), or plasticizer migration over time. Under these conditions, our film has a shelf life of up to 12 months.
